How Common Is The Last Name Pfening? popularity and diffusion
The last name Pfening is the 980,795th most commonly used family name globally, held by around 1 in 27,709,300 people. The surname is predominantly found in Europe, where 56 percent of Pfening reside; 28 percent reside in Eastern Europe and 27 percent reside in Germanic Europe.
The last name is most commonly occurring in Germany, where it is borne by 72 people, or 1 in 1,118,131. In Germany it is most frequent in: Lower Saxony, where 58 percent are found, North Rhine-Westphalia, where 21 percent are found and Hesse, where 13 percent are found. Excluding Germany it occurs in 9 countries. It is also common in Russia, where 21 percent are found and The United States, where 20 percent are found.
